About This Property

Arbour House Farm Bungalow in Durham can sleep six people in three bedrooms.

Arbour House Farm Bungalow, a single-storey home with a kitchen with a breakfast bar, range oven and hob, fridge/freezer, dishwasher, microwave, kettle, toaster and a utility room with a washing machine and tumble dryer. The sitting room has a Smart TV and a gas-effect log burner, with a dining table. There are three king-size bedrooms, with one being a zip-link (can be twin on request). Outside, there is a private driveway for three cars, as well as plenty of off-road parking and a non-enclosed lawned garden with gravel, decking, outdoor furniture, a hot tub and firepit. Two well-behaved pets are welcome, but this is a smoke-free property. Bed linen, towels, fuel, power and electric are all provided. You’ll find the closest shop within 0.4 miles, and a pub in 1.1 miles. Arbour House Farm Bungalow is ideal for a family or a group of friends seeking a countryside escape with amenities close by. Note: There are steps up to the decking and hot tub in the garden, please take care.

Situated in one of the most beautiful counties of England, Durham city is one of the jewels in England’s crown. Dominated by the historic centre, a World Heritage Site, the city is home to magnificent Durham Cathedral, with its breath-taking vaulted ceiling and splendid architecture. The cathedral, the final resting place of the Venerable Bede, is one of the finest examples of Norman architecture in the whole of Europe. Durham Castle stands side by side with the cathedral, on a prominent hilltop site, encircled by the wooded slopes of the River Wear below. The city itself offers elegant buildings and fascinating narrow streets with excellent shopping, eating and drinking to suit all tastes. Add to that the ease of access to the rest of this historic county, “Land of the Prince Bishops”, and Durham has much to offer the discerning traveller, from Medieval castles to marvellous landscapes and scenic walks. Durham city is the ideal location for discovering this beautiful county.
